Legionella Awareness Accredited Course Overview: This course will provide you with an insightful background knowledge of legionella. It will also enable you to manage, and implement the requirement to monitor water systems to ensure ACOP compliance. Who Is This Course For: This course is designed for those who are involved in the implementation of the written scheme, and who are responsible for maintaining site log books. Key Learning Areas Covered In This Course: • • Water Systems Safety – background • • Legionellosis – medical aspects • • Awareness of both statutory and non-statutory health and safety requirements • • Monitoring requirements of hot and cold water systems • • Flushing regimes • • Water sampling requirements • • Records and log books Course Duration/Locations: 1 day training course, available in York, Slough and Falkirk Course Fees: £260+VAT per delegate.
